Workshop on Good Dairy Farming Practices held on 3rd – 4th May, 2019 in Gwandagaji, Birnin Kebbi, Kebbi State with 150 participants in attendance. As part of FMARD’s obligations to identify clusters/cooperatives and link dairy farmers to processors it became important to build the capacity of dairy farmers in modern dairy farming for increased milk production. The workshop provided pastoralists with an understanding of the modern dairy business model, its benefits and key drivers to enable them move from subsistence farming to small scale dairy farming as a business. It also discussed constraints and challenges farmers face with access to key productive inputs, production and integration into the formal sector. The workshop is expected to elicit feedback on challenges and the support required to unlock dairy farmers’ potential. The program would be replicated in other states soon.
